Machine Washing Use a top-loading washing machine for best results when cleaning faux fur blankets at home. Set the machine to the delicate cycle and fill it with cold water. As the machine fills, add mild laundry detergent, such as a formula created for delicate fabrics.

Furthermore, how do you wash a Pottery Barn fur blanket?

CARE AND MAINTENANCE

  1. Machine wash cold; gentle cycle.
  2. Use only non-chlorine bleach when needed.
  3. Tumble dry low.
  4. Dry clean recommended.

Beside above, how do you wash a fur blanket? Fill the washing machine with cold water and set it to the delicate cycle. Make sure to wash the faux fur blanket separately without adding any other items to the machine. Add mild detergent to the water, preferably a product that is specifically usable for delicate fabrics.

Beside above, how do you wash a Pottery Barn comforter?

CARE AND MAINTENANCE

  1. Spot clean with distilled water when necessary.
  2. Machine wash in warm water in a commercial sized washer; gentle cycle.
  3. Tumble dry low in a commercial-sized dryer, remove promptly when dry.
  4. Stop dryer frequently to turn center out to ensure center dries to avoid scorching.

How can I make my blankets fluffy again?

Vinegar Can Make Blankets Fluffy Again Get blankets looking and feeling almost new by washing them in a long cycle with only white vinegar and no other laundry products — not even detergent. The vinegar will cut through the buildup and loosen the fibers.

Can you put faux fur in the dryer?

Drying Faux Fur. Air-dry faux fur. Never use an electric dryer, even on a no-heat setting, because the friction caused by the faux fur item tumbling around in the dryer creates heat that destroys the fibers.

How do you clean a furry pillow?

If it is acrylic, wash the pillow by hand in cold water or in the machine on the gentle cycle using a mild detergent. Once it has been cleaned, fluff the furry fibers and hang or lay it out to dry. Do not put the pillow in the dryer. Even a small amount of heat could melt or permanently mat the fibers.

Can you wash Pottery Barn quilts?

Care Instructions Unless noted, all Pottery Barn Teen sheeting and quilted bedding is machine washable. For best results, wash bedding before first use. Wash in cold or warm water (as specified) and tumble dry on low or medium heat (as specified). Remove promptly from the dryer.

Can you put a fleece blanket in the washing machine?

Place the blankets in your washing machine. To prevent abrasion with other clothes, it is best to wash fleece items together, combining like colors. Use only warm, not hot, water on fleece. Add laundry detergent to the washing machine, but do not use a laundry detergent that contains bleach.

How do you wash a fuzzy blanket without ruining it?

To ensure years of cozy comfort, wash separately in cold water on the gentle cycle using your usual detergent. Use only non-chlorine bleach as needed. We recommend line drying, but if you're in a hurry, you can also put the blanket in the dryer on the no-heat setting (sometimes called 'air fluff').

How do you make a Minky blanket soft again?

Washing your minky blanket with fabric softener may take away some of the softness of your blanket, but you can try to bring back that softness by washing your blanket in cold water and vinegar (do not add laundry detergent).
